London, United Kingdom | full time | Job ID: 11340

About the role:

As Director Statistical Programming you will work alongside the Head/Sr. Director of Statistical Programming as portfolio lead for the Infectious Diseases therapeutic area (e.g., COVID‑19, malaria, monkeypox, HIV, HSV, tuberculosis), implementing a comprehensive statistical programming strategy that maximizes efficiency and quality across the portfolio while ensuring alignment with corporate and regulatory requirements. You will be responsible for overseeing statistical programming deliverables across multiple Infectious Diseases programs and studies (early- and late-stage), including analysis datasets (e.g., SDTM, ADaM), tables, listings, and figures (TLFs), integrated summaries, and other regulatory deliverables and ensure programming strategies are aligned with compound/platform objectives, indication‑specific needs, and regulatory expectations.

Your main responsibilities are:

  • Lead the programming contribution to global regulatory submissions (e.g., NDAs, BLAs, MAAs, rolling submissions, emergency use authorizations) for Infectious Diseases assets, ensuring compliance with eCTD requirements, and high‑quality, submission‑ready datasets, TLFs, and documentation (e.g., define.xml, reviewers’ guides)
  • Develop and oversee data standards, tools and automation for efficient production and verification of derived datasets (e.g., SDTM and ADaM) and TLFs, including portfolio‑wide solutions for recurrent endpoints (e.g., virology, immunogenicity, efficacy and safety outcomes) in infectious diseases
  • Drive the creation, review, and validation of SAS/R programs for clinical data analysis across multiple infectious disease studies and integrated analyses, ensuring compliance with SOPs, regulatory standards, and principles of reproducibility and traceability
  • Collaborate cross‑functionally with Clinical Development, Clinical Operations, Pharmacovigilance, Regulatory Affairs, Translational Medicine, and other stakeholders to meet project deliverables and timelines for statistical data analysis and reporting across the Infectious Diseases portfolio and representing statistical programming in clinical study teams, portfolio governance, protocol reviews, and submission readiness meetings
  • Guide and collaborate with internal Global Biometric Sciences (GBS) project leads and CRO/FSP staff to ensure alignment with established data, analysis, and quality standards. Provide direction and oversight to external partners delivering programming services for Infectious Diseases projects
  • Champion the adoption of advanced analytics, automation tools (e.g., SAS macros, R/Python workflows), and new technologies (e.g., AI/ML, data visualization, decentralized trials, real‑world evidence) within the Infectious Diseases portfolio to enhance programming efficiency and scientific insight
  • Identify, define, and monitor programming metrics to assess performance and quality for the Infectious Diseases portfolio. Evaluate existing processes and guidelines, propose enhancements, and implement changes for continuous process improvement and operational excellence
  • Participate in, and as appropriate lead, continuous improvement activities and process reengineering initiatives in support of BioNTech’s global clinical and data strategy, contributing Infectious Diseases portfolio perspectives and requirements
  • Provide leadership, coaching, and mentoring to programming staff (internal and external) supporting Infectious Diseases, fostering technical excellence, professional development, and a culture of collaboration and innovation

What you have to offer: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Statistics, Mathematics, Computer Science or related discipline, advanced degree preferred
  • 15+ years (10+ years for advanced degree) experience in a pharmaceutical industry, CRO or another clinical research setting, with a focus on infectious diseases
  • Excellent knowledge of statistical programming in SAS including Base, macro, STAT, GRAPH, SQL
  • Solid understanding of FDA, EMA, ICH, and global regulations and guidelines
  • Solid understanding of industry standards applicable to clinical study data and reporting on clinical trials, including CDISC standards
  • Solid understanding of the drug development process from early- to late-stage development and submission
  • Expertise in the requirements and technology to support electronic submissions
  • Strong project and portfolio management skills
  • Strong interpersonal skills in addition to exceptional written and oral communication skills commensurate with the need to work closely with CROs, investigators, consultants, and team members across functions
  • Ability to lead cross-functional teams and influence stakeholders in a matrix organization
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ced and dynamic environment and manage multiple programs simultaneously
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with a focus on innovation, automation, and continuous improvement
